Here’s some thoughts on the flight coming from a more social/casual player (I played on PC)
UI / Menus
The user experience of the menus could be much better. Its way more complex than necessary to navigate through the different menus. My suggestion would be to have the Settings and Battle Pass/Challenges accessible at the top with Play and Customize and Store. Also keep that menu at the top in every screen so that we can jump from menu to menu without having to go back and forth to the main screen. You can see Warzone or Fortnite lobbies as examples of this kind of menu navigation. - Navigating with a mouse also isn’t very intuitive, in some screens like the battle pass, hovering over an item would show it on the preview (when it worked), this isn’t the case in the menu where you test weapons. The first time I used it I wanted to see what weapon I was selecting by hovering over its name but the preview image would only change if I selected it and took me into the different drills, having to go back and repeat the process with each weapon I didn’t know the name of. - I know there’s a hotkey to equip something in the customize menu, but in order to do it with the mouse I have to click on a really small check box, this could also be more intuitive.HUD
I also felt the HUD could use some improvements but it might be a more personal preference. Its also all positioned at the bottom of the screen while the top is almost empty. Also some elements like medals and ammo/grenade counters are too small. Having the ability to customize the position/size of each element on the screen would be amazing for personalization and accessibility (including the crosshair like in MCC on PC maybe?). - I miss being able to see how many of each grenade I have at any given time like in Halo 3 as well as seeing the bullet icons deplete as I shoot as opposed to just having numbers.Bots
My only issue with bots is that they’re way too precise with the sidekick at ODST+ difficulty and if they spot you at a distance they can very quickly kill you with it.Weapons
Almost every weapon felt useful and balanced, except for the Heatwave, it felt very underpowered and the way the projectiles bounced off surfaces wasn’t as predictable as I expected.Overall thoughts
I’m just nitpicking because these are the only complaints I could have so far about the test. Overall I really enjoyed my time in it and I’m somehow more hyped for Infinite than I was before it.
